Description
In the palace of Versailles the people dress, eat, and act like it’ s the eighteenth century-- with the added bonus of technology to make court life lavish, privileged, and frivolous. When Danica witnesses an act of murder by the young king, her mother blackmails the king into making Dani his queen. When she turns eighteen, Dani will marry the most ruthless and dangerous man of the court. She has six months to raise enough money to disappear into the real world. Her ticket out? Glitter. A drug so powerful that a tiny pinch mixed into a pot of rouge or lip gloss can make the wearer hopelessly addicted....
